Mark 4:17-24 Common English Bible (CEB)

17. Because they have no roots, they last for only a little while. When they experience distress or abuse because of the word, they immediately fall away.

18. Others are like the seed scattered among the thorny plants. These are the ones who have heard the word;

19. but the worries of this life, the false appeal of wealth, and the desire for more things break in and choke the word, and it bears no fruit.

20. The seed scattered on good soil are those who hear the word and embrace it. They bear fruit, in one case a yield of thirty to one, in another case sixty to one, and in another case one hundred to one."

21. Jesus said to them, "Does anyone bring in a lamp in order to put it under a basket or a bed? Shouldn’t it be placed on a lampstand?

22. Everything hidden will be revealed, and everything secret will come out into the open.

23. Whoever has ears to listen should pay attention!"

24. He said to them, "Listen carefully! God will evaluate you with the same standard you use to evaluate others. Indeed, you will receive even more.
